Detailed Description
Simple SpectrumPhy implementation that sends customizable waveform. The generated waveforms have a given Spectrum Power Density and duration (set with the SetResolution()) . The generator activates and deactivates periodically with a given period and with a duty cycle of 1/2.

Attributes defined for this type:
-
Period: the period (=1/frequency)
-
Set with class: TimeValue
-
Underlying type: Time
-
Initial value: 1000000000ns
-
Flags: construct write read
-
DutyCycle: the duty cycle of the generator, i.e., the fraction of the period that is occupied by a signal
-
Set with class: ns3::DoubleValue
-
Underlying type: double -1.79769e+308:1.79769e+308
-
Initial value: 0.5
-
Flags: construct write read
TraceSources defined for this type:
-
TxStart: Trace fired when a new transmission is started
-
TxEnd: Trace fired when a previosuly started transmission is finished
